Poggiridenti is a northern Italian municipality ( comune ) with 1852 inhabitants (as of December 31, 2019) in the province of Sondrio in Lombardy .
geography
The municipality is located about 4.5 kilometers east-northeast of Sondrio on the Adda in the Veltlin Valley. The neighboring municipalities are Montagna in Valtellina , Piateda and Tresivio .
history
The community is first mentioned in the 12th century; at that time the area called Pendolasco was a court of the municipality of Tresivio. The name of the Da Pendolasco family, which assumed the status of noblewoman in the 16th century, is also derived from the place name. According to the documents signed by Bishop Feliciano Ninguarda, there are around 600 inhabitants in Pendolasco in 1589. Plague and famine ravaged the area at least until the end of the seventeenth century. The first demographic rise and improvement in economic conditions are confirmed in 1706. During the Napoleonic period, the area was part of the Cisalpine Republic and, after the Congress of Vienna, the Kingdom of Lombardy-Veneto , like the entire province of Sondrio. In 1816, the Pieve of Pendolasco separated from Montagna and became an autonomous municipality. In 1861, after the Second War of Independence , it became part of the Kingdom of Italy .
traffic
The Strada Statale 38 dello Stelvio leads through the municipality coming from Piantedo over the Stilfser Joch . The train station of Poggiridenti together with the neighboring communities Tresivio and Piateda is located on the Ferrovia Alta Valtellina .
